Zachary and Jordan Wiskow of Indian Trail, NC, members of the Manchester, NH-based Young Rescuers USA, are making their final preparations to participate at the International Rally of Young Rescuers and Firefighters on July 15 through 27th. The program is hosted by the Ministry for Emergency Situations of the Republic of Belarus,

The program is available to seven youths from the United States between the ages of 13 and 17. 

Fourteen-year-old Zachary and Jordan, 12, and the rest of their team members will depart for Belarus from Logan National Airport on Sunday, July 14th.

While in Belarus the Young Rescuers learn and compete in basic life safety exercises, enjoy excursions to cultural, scenic, and historic sites and make lasting international friendships, all to the benefit of the U.S., said program founder and former U.S. Ambassador George Bruno.

“We are very proud of our Young Rescuers USA 2013 team. They have worked very hard for this international competition and will serve as great representatives of the USA in Belarus,” said David Tille, president of Young Rescuers USA of Concord, NH.

Zachary and Jordan are the grandsons of Marie and Bob Shue and Jim Tille of Old Forge.
